Black turned the role of the angry curmudgeon railing against the injustices of our times into a cottage industry, becoming a favorite among an increasingly skeptical and cynical audience that has ranged in age from teenagers to the elderly. Prior to "The Daily Show," Black toiled in stand-up comedy, performing at clubs and venues across the United States, while trying desperately to become a successful playwright.But it was his grumbling grouse character developed over the years in front of a microphone, that finally launched Black into celebrity, a slow process that brought the comedian eventual triumph at twice the age of other comedians around him.Although Black left "The Daily Show" in early 2016, he continued his stand-up and writing careers, as well as taking on high profile voice gigs such as playing the emotion Anger in Pixar's "Inside Out" (2015).Lewis Black made a living as both a stand-up comic and as a weekly commentator on the popular mock news program, "The Daily Show" (Comedy Central, 1996- ).

Had the COVID-19 pandemic not wreaked havoc in 2020 and canceled pretty much everything, The Black Rep would be celebrating its 50th season this year. As it is, the company, founded by Ron Himes in 1976, officially began season 49 on Sept. 3 this year when “Raisin” opened at Edison Theatre on Washington University in St. Louis’ campus.Gen Horiuchi brings Broadway, classical ballet and original choreography to St. Louis · The Black Rep’s season will continue with Samm-Art Williams’ dark comedy, “Dance on Widow’s Row,” performed Jan. 7 to 25, 2026, at Edison Theatre. It’s about four wealthy Southern widows “with deadly reputations,” who host a gathering to get closer to the town’s most promising bachelors.According to the Black Rep, this is the first time an August Wilson play has been translated to Italian and performed in St. Louis. The cast, directed by Renzo Carbonera, will be made up of Italian actors from Africa from the Teatro di Sardegna.St. Louis’ Black Rep brings a mix of old and new in 2025-26 season

EXCLUSIVE: After 35-plus years as a touring stand-up comedian, Lewis Black is preparing to park his tour bus for good.Comedian Lewis Black has announced his retirement from touring, along with his final set of dates.On the road through next month to wrap up his 2023 Off the Rails tour, Black this morning unveiled the dates for Goodbye Yeller Brick Road, The Final Tour, which is set to take place throughout North America and Europe from January 2024 through 2025. Tickets go on sale Friday, November 17 at 10 a.m.Black also spoke about the “great joy” he’s taken from touring and the “world of possibilities” it’s opened for him over the years. “I thought the road would go on forever, well I was wrong about that. And the fact is as hard as the road maybe to be on, it’s harder to leave it,” he said.

Lewis Black was born on August 30, 1948, in Washington, D.C., the elder son of Jeannette Black (née Kaplan; 1918–2022), a teacher, and Samuel Black (1918–2019), an artist and mechanical engineer. He had a younger brother, Ronald, who died of cancer in 1997 at the age of 47. He is Jewish and was raised in a middle-class Jewish family in the Burnt Mills neighborhood of Silver Spring, Maryland. His grandparents emigrated from Chornyi Ostriv in Ukraine and Białystok in Poland and his paternal grandfather was originally named Leib Blech, later changed to Louis Black.He hosted the Comedy Central series Lewis Black's Root of All Evil and makes regular appearances on The Daily Show delivering his "Back in Black" commentary segment, which he has been doing since The Daily Show was hosted by Craig Kilborn. He was voted 51st of the 100 greatest stand-up comedians of all time by Comedy Central in 2004 and was voted 5th in Comedy Central's Stand Up Showdown in 2008 and 11th in 2010.Lewis Black is also a spokesman for the Aruba Tourism Authority, appearing in television ads that first aired in late 2009 and 2010. He has served as an "ambassador for voting rights" for the American Civil Liberties Union since 2013. After graduating in 1970, Black moved to Colorado Springs with a group of performers based in Chapel Hill, purchased an old log cabin theater and attempted to establish a theater company.Black's career began in theater as a playwright; however, he has stated that he was always doing stand-up "on the side." He served as the playwright-in-residence and associate artistic director of Steve Olsen's West Bank Cafe Downstairs Theatre Bar in Hell's Kitchen in New York City, where he collaborated with composer and lyricist Rusty Magee and artistic director Rand Foerster on hundreds of one-act plays from 1981 to 1989.

Louis was chosen for spraying experiments specifically because of its physical similarities to Moscow. According to the National Research Council, its population density, terrain and river access made it an ideal analog for the Soviet city. The residents — most of them Black and most of them poor — say they were never told.The summer of 1953 in St. Louis was relentless. The heat beat down on the brick facade of Pruitt-Igoe, the air heavy, clinging to 33 concrete towers that almost seemed to hold the sun captive. Children played outside, the shouts of their games echoing between high-rises.In the 1950s and ’60s, the U.S. Army sprayed zinc cadmium sulfide — a compound containing cadmium, a known carcinogen — in the city of St. Louis. The government now admits to a secretive series of Cold War-era tests, including one dubbed “Large Area Coverage.” More than 30 tests were carried out in the U.S.ST.
